Sancton Wood is a Cambridge-based all-through independent school (nursery to Year 13) emphasizing academic rigour alongside pastoral care and enrichment. The school positions itself as nurturing 'bright futures' through a blend of traditional academics and contemporary approaches to wellbeing, featuring a 'Thriving Minds' programme for gifted pupils and hybrid learning options. As a day-only coed school of moderate size (397 pupils), it occupies a middle ground between Cambridge's selective preparatory feeders and its boarding independents.

  • All-through provision from age 3 to 18, reducing transition disruption
  • Strong emphasis on able and gifted pupil enrichment via 'Thriving Minds' programme
  • Cambridge location with accessible transport and town-gown integration
  • Pastoral care framework and 'values-led' ethos emphasizing wellbeing alongside academics

Who thrives here

Academically capable, intellectually curious pupils who benefit from structured enrichment and a stable, continuous school community; families seeking day-only independent provision without boarding pressure; parents valuing breadth across STEM, arts, and pastoral development.

Frequently asked questions

What are the fees at Sancton Wood School?

Day fees at Sancton Wood School are approximately £23,370 per year (2025/26).

How do you get into Sancton Wood School?

Sancton Wood School admits pupils at 3+, 4+, 7+, 8+, 11+, 13+, 16+. Entry is assessed by Interview, Assessment. See the Admissions section above for open days and key dates.

What are Sancton Wood School's exam results?

At Sancton Wood School, 29.8% of GCSEs were grade 7/A or above. Full results are in the Results section above.

Is Sancton Wood School a boarding school?

Sancton Wood School is a day school in England and does not offer boarding.

What is Sancton Wood School's latest inspection rating?

ISI rated Sancton Wood School “Excellent” (2022).
